HubSpot: Built-In Security Without Extra Hassle

Key Takeaway: HubSpot is SOC 3 and SOC 2 Type 2 certified, which means it has undergone rigorous auditing to ensure stringent security and privacy standards. Additionally, its CRM hub is HIPAA compliant—a critical feature for industries that handle sensitive information.

The best part? Security and data privacy are standard features in HubSpot. Businesses don’t need extra time, resources, or budget to maintain security—it’s all included in the subscription agreement.

WordPress: A Growing Security Concern

Key Takeaway: WordPress hacks are on the rise, and with the advancements in AI, cyberattacks are projected to escalate even further.

Unlike HubSpot, WordPress requires constant monitoring and manual security management. Companies must depend on their individual WordPress webmaster's skills, knowledge, and expertise to maintain security—leaving significant room for error.
